LINUX.ORG.RU

Патч для ядра Linux, позволяющий увеличить время работы ноутбука от батарей


0

0

Jens Axboe опубликовал патч для 2.4.x Linux ядер, позволяющий уменьшить энергопотребление в ноутбуке работающем под Linux. Экономия достигается благодаря уменьшению времени активности (реже возникает необходимость "просыпаться") жесткого диска, одного из самых энергоемких устройств в ноутбуках.

Патч для ядра 2.4.21-rc2: http://www.kerneltrap.org/sup/653/lap...

Init-script: http://www.kerneltrap.org/sup/653/lap...

Существует также userspace-демон с похожей функциональностью, noflushd: http://noflushd.sourceforge.net/

>>> Подробности



Проверено: green

Вах, надо будет испытать... Буквально пару дней назад ноут купил БУ-шный, там зарядки часа на полтора хватает ;-)

P.S. А никто не знает, где под 3COM EtherLink III + 33.6 Modem - COMBO Card (PCMCIA, чипы зовутся 3C562D/3C563D) модули/дровишки надыбать, малость погуглил - не помогло...

sseREGa
()

О! Мало того что я первый, так еще давайте патчи замутим, которые не будут юзать оперативку и монитор! И настанет всем счастье )))

P.S. Комментарий конкретно к новости - "Че за ботва?" (с) Гоблин и Ко

anonymous
()

Ответ к коментарию о новости:
У Гоблина мозги есть, а у тебя их что-то не наблюдается. Вот такая ботва.

jackill
()

кто-нибудь юже заюзал?

anonymous
()

миля а чем вас apm неустраивает ?

anonymous
()

card "3Com 3c562/3c563 Ethernet/Modem" manfid 0x0101, 0x0562 bind "3c589_cs" to 0, "serial_cs" to 1

поддерживается pcmcia без проблем

anonymous
()

Народ а какой лучше всего ноутбук для Линуха покупать ?
У меня вот щас возможность появилась, и никак немогу решиться. :)

Proton911
()
Ответ на: комментарий от Proton911

главное чтоб APM поддерживал, а то ACPI заеб%%%%% настраивать и всё равно как надо не настроишь, тк ACPI дрова под linux'ом - говно

anonymous
()

основные траблы (решаемые) у нотбуков и линуксов с винмодемами и лсд-дисплеями. я дак например так и не смог настроить в slackware усб-мышь хотя тачпад работает без проблем (во freebsd все с точностью до наоборот). короче все опционально и зависит от производителя :)

anonymous
()

Proton911: > Народ а какой лучше всего ноутбук для Линуха покупать ?

У меня Toshiba Satellite Pro 6100. Ни каких проблем кроме модема.

anonymous
()

Для линукса ИМХО лучше IMB ThinkPad-ы брать, из 600-ых серий. Есть все, включая поддержку встроенного винмодема и frame-buffer support на видеокарту. И не дорого... Для работы - самое то (но не для игр)..

anonymous
()

насчет поддержки ACPI - согласен, кривущая она безмерно. Я как включил ACPI на моем ThinkPad 600 - так кулер на процессоре (который сам должен включатся/выключаться от температуры), застыл на месте... А поскольку он довольно тихий, заметил это только когда верхняя крышка от ноута раскалилась... Но все обошлось, но больше ACPI я не ставлю...

anonymous
()

Значит так :

ACPI работает прекрасно -> SuSE 8.2 Professional
USB Mouse работает великолепно -> SuSE 8.2 Professional
LCD(TFT) работают "на ура" -> SuSE 8.2 Professional

SuSE 8.2 Professional ISO брать здесь (но скорость ГОВНО :)

http://freesoft.online.sh.cn/mirrors/SuSE/8.2/MD5SUM
http://freesoft.online.sh.cn/mirrors/SuSE/8.2/SuSE.Linux.i386.x86.8.2.Profess...
http://freesoft.online.sh.cn/mirrors/SuSE/8.2/SuSE.Linux.i386.x86.8.2.Profess...
http://freesoft.online.sh.cn/mirrors/SuSE/8.2/SuSE.Linux.i386.x86.8.2.Profess...
http://freesoft.online.sh.cn/mirrors/SuSE/8.2/SuSE.Linux.i386.x86.8.2.Profess...
http://freesoft.online.sh.cn/mirrors/SuSE/8.2/SuSE.Linux.i386.x86.8.2.Profess...

У одного товарища даже на Gericom встала и не виснет,
что было с предидущими версиями. Но Gericom не
Laptop/Notebook,это compact standalone pc вобщем ГОВНО :)
До это стоял там Win2000 и тихо умирал, короче ГОВНО :)

anonymous
()

ASUS L3800c - работает все, кроме ACPI даже модем. И вообще, ноут отличный

anonymous
()

Имею подрежанный DELL Latitude CPx H450GT - Rulezzzzz!!! Всё работает, но ACPI не тсавил, может сочтете за ламерство но на кой он нужен?

cyclon
()

ACPI

все, написавшие про acpi, либо клинические идиоты, либо владельцы ноутов пятилетней давности. ни один современный ноут не будет работать с apm вообще ;) просто потому, что они больше не поддерживают apm:
не будет показывать состояния батареи.
не будет выключаться после шатдауна.
не будет возможности регулировать частоту процессора (throttling).
не будет возможности получать события от power button/sleep button/lid
с очень большой вероятностью устройства не получат правильные прерывания и все будет смешно глючить.
засыпать/просыпаться тоже не будет. не говоря уж о suspend-to-disk.

еще в acpi есть "thermal zones" - можно мониторить температуру процессора без всяких lm_sensors...

а чтобы acpi нормально работал, рекосендуется накладывать на ядро последний acpi патч с http://acpi.sourceforge.net, ну и по желанию с
http://fchabaud.free.fr/English/default.php3?COUNT=3&FILE0=Tricks&FIL...

в общем, учите матчасть, пионеры...

dixi.

crz
()

ACPI

s/рекосендуется/рекомендуется

crz
()
Ответ на: комментарий от anonymous

У меня тоже ASUS L3800C и я им очень доволен (SuSE 8.2 Prof). Вот ссылочка на патчи ACPI для ASUS L3C

http://www.galnet.net/

> Народ а какой лучше всего ноутбук для Линуха покупать?

Можно посмотреть что и как работает на

http://www.linux-laptop.net/

anonymous
()
Ответ на: комментарий от anonymous

вот с чем так это с LCD никаких проблем нету под Linux'ом

anonymous
()
Ответ на: ACPI от crz

Compaq Evo 610, относительно новый ноутбук, с APM работает, с ACPI никак, наклыдывание последнего патча с sf.net не спасает

anonymous
()
Ответ на: ACPI от crz

нука расскажи нам "клиническим идиотам" как ACPI под linux'ом
настраивать, да так, чтоб не только зарядку аккумулятора
показывалась, но и
1) можно было сделать suspend
2) можно было сделать hibernate
3) переключение скорости вращения вентилятора осуществлялось
корректно и не зависело от модели ноута, а то
на одном относительно корректно переключает, на другом - х@$

anonymous
()
Ответ на: комментарий от anonymous

ACPI


1) echo S3 > /proc/acpi/sleep
2) swsusp патч и соответствующий скрипт.
3) это работает, если работают thermal zones. если у тебя с проблемы - пиши багрепорт. на toshiba/dell/sony/acer/ibm проблем нет.

еще вопросы?

crz
()
Ответ на: ACPI от crz

1)не работает на Compaq

anonymous
()

все что нужно по использованию линукса на ноуте есть на tuxmobile.org

anonymous
()

Купил ноут Bliss 4010 (http://bliss.ru)
Всё под Линуксом запустил - видео с XV и DRI, CD writer, USB, тачпад, сеть, даже винмодем.
А вот с ACPI всё ещё траблы. Состояние батарей получить могу, да выключение по шатдауну работает. Да термал зонес. И всё.

При попытке записи чего-либо в /proc/acpi/sleep - либо никакой реакции, либо мёртвое зависание.
/proc/acpi/FAN пустое, а порой так хочется замедлить проц - благо cpufreq патч (http://www.brodo.de/cpufreq_old/24stable.html) работает - и заткнуть нафиг эту гуделку ...

2.4.21rc2 + последний патч с acpi.sf.net

Не знаю что с этим делать. Очень похоже на глюки на уровне таблиц в биосе. Про это на acpi.sf.net много написано ...

yoush
()

ни у кого ACPI не работает у одного только crz работает, другие поэтому возможно 2 случая либо он пиздит либо использует какие-то другие ACPI патчи, не те что на sf.net лежат

anonymous
()

>У меня тоже ASUS L3800C и я им очень доволен (SuSE 8.2 Prof). Вот >ссылочка на патчи ACPI для ASUS L3C >http://www.galnet.net/

а на другие ядра есть? интересно бы для RH9 или 2.5.х.

anonymous
()

ну у меня работает на ровере... даже спидстеп вроде... кстати - вообще все железо работает, правда ирда только в сир, но мне хватает. Ну и до выхода 4.3 иксов были проблемы с радеоном в неродных разрешениях матрицы, приходилось сидеть под 1400х1024, что по началу напрягало.

debosh2k
()
Ответ на: комментарий от anonymous

ACPI

> crz , а acpi пропатченый бэкпортом с 2.5? или "родной" 2.4.х?
$ uname -a
Linux crzlptp 2.4.21rc1a #4 Сбт Апр 26 09:17:33 EEST 2003 i686 unknown unknown GNU/Linux

linux-2.4.20.tar.bz2
и на него
1. patch-2.4.21-rc1.bz2
2. acpi-20030424-2.4.21-rc1.diff.gz

работает все.

пробовал также acpi-20030228-2.4.21-pre4.diff + patch-acpi-acpi20030228-swsusp19
тоже все работало, включая hibernate.

ноут - acer tm225xc.
есть второй, постарше - dell cpt600gt
и на нем все пашет.
на тех, что я упоминал выше (не мои), внимание - сюрприз, тоже работало.
если кто не верит - приезжайте и убедитесь лично.

crz
()
Ответ на: ACPI от crz

у crz точно какая-то нестандартная система `uname -a` информацию как-то криво выдаёт, почему-то после 'unknown' идёт ещё 'unknown GNU/Linux'

anonymous
()
Ответ на: комментарий от anonymous

Да ты че, ваще 'unknown' щас немодно ;)

Linux car.linuxhacker.ru 2.4.20 #2 SMP Sun Dec 1 20:13:04 MSK 2002 i686 i686 i386 GNU/Linux

green
()

а у меня почему так выдаёт:
Linux pentiumiii 2.4.20 #1 Птн Май 16 12:41:54 MSD 2003 i686 unknown

?
то есть полей меньше

anonymous
()

HP OmniBook XE3 gf RH 7.3 + Всё работает(даже винмодем) кроме apm (battery) и FIR (IRDA работает)

anonymous
()

а уменя Omnibook 500, всё работает (sound,apm,сеть,irda и тд), а модем - нет и работать не будет так как он от 3com :-(

anonymous
()

Кто-нибудь пользовал ноутбуки iru под линуксом? Поделитесь, пожалуйста, впечатлиниями. Evgeny

anonymous
()
2 июля 2003 г.
Ответ на: комментарий от anonymous

У меня XE3l поделись как модем поднял? У меня модем на ESS чипе.

anonymous
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.